Bios7.bin — Dsi
When developers write emulators like melonDS or No$GBA, they have two choices for handling a console's internal operating system: High-Level Emulation (HLE) or Low-Level Emulation (LLE).
The is a binary file representing the system BIOS (Basic Input/Output System) for the ARM7 processor, which is one of the two main processors found in the Nintendo DS and DSi hardware.
Because the BIOS files contain copyrighted software written by Nintendo, hosting or distributing them online without authorization is illegal. Downloading these files from third-party ROM or emulation sites violates copyright laws. The Legal Method: Dumping Your Own Files
: A mismatch between the BIOS files and the nand.bin or firmware.bin .
This comprehensive guide explains what the file is, why emulators require it, and how to utilize it legally and effectively. What is dsi bios7.bin? dsi bios7.bin
Ensure the file is exactly 64 KB. If the file is 4 KB or 8 KB, you have likely dumped a standard DS BIOS instead of a DSi BIOS. Check the file extensions and ensure there are no hidden double extensions (like dsi_bios7.bin.txt ). Black Screen on Boot
: This indicates your bios7.bin file may be corrupted, truncated, or from a standard Nintendo DS instead of a DSi. Ensure your file size is exactly correct (the DSi bios7.bin is typically 64 KB, while the original DS version is 4 KB).
For developers and those interested in homebrew (self-made or community-created software for gaming consoles), understanding and modifying BIOS files like "dsi bios7.bin" can be essential. Homebrew development on the DSi involves creating software that can run on the device without official support. This often requires a deep understanding of the device's hardware and software architecture.
It configures the power management chips, Wi-Fi modules, and basic input/output sub-systems. When developers write emulators like melonDS or No$GBA,
The emulator recreates the actual hardware environment and runs the original console software.
: Check the box that says "Enable DS-mode/DSi-mode custom BIOS/Firmware". Click Browse next to each slot and target your respective files ( bios7.bin in the ARM7 slot, bios9.bin in the ARM9 slot).
Boot your DSi into the GodMode9i homebrew application, which is a powerful file browser for DS hardware.
It is crucial to understand that BIOS files are proprietary software owned by Nintendo. Distributing or downloading them from unofficial sources is copyright infringement and illegal in most jurisdictions. Downloading these files from third-party ROM or emulation
ARM7TDMI (running at 33.514 MHz in DSi mode). Core Functions
The file is the binary dump of the ARM7 processor's Basic Input/Output System (BIOS) from a Nintendo DSi console.
Because the dsi_bios7.bin file contains proprietary code copyrighted by Nintendo, downloading it from third-party websites or ROM-sharing platforms violates copyright laws in most jurisdictions. The Legal Method: Hardware Dumping